An exploration of the reasons that a film adaptation of "Dune Messiah" is likely to generate significant pushback or even distaste among general audiences, even while it has the potential to be a beloved installment for dedicated fans of the series. Ever since it was reported that Denis Villeneuve intended to conclude his adaptation of Frank Herbert’s Dune saga with his second book, Dune Messiah, fans of the series have been speculating about how audiences will react. While at first glance Dune might appear to be a tale of heroic triumph for Paul Atreides, its sequel—Dune Messiah—presents an unsettling and profoundly challenging portrait of Paul’s reign. This jarring transition from apparent heroism to what seems like villainy is crucial to understanding Herbert's grander vision. This is also why mainstream audiences may find it difficult to digest, even as die-hard fans revel in its thematic depth and complexity.
